Check the Wild Trailer for a Chinese Basketball Movie with Carmelo, Dwight Howard, Yao, and More

What is this? Well, apparently it's a movie. And it's about to come out in China. Learn more (or less) from the trailer below.

[H/T: Sports Grid]

